I've tried two different Besson 4v compensating CC's, and both had some pretty major tuning problems. I know that they make some that do play in tune, as the the guy in London Phil. played one for many years. I tried one from the WW&BW for which they were asking next to nothing, but it wouldn't have been worth fighting the intonation problems that it had, IMHO. It was also difficult to get a big sound out of it (for me, anyway), as it had the smaller British m.p. receiver. Of course, one could easily have the receiver changed, or the entire lead pipe for that matter. Does yours have the smaller British receiver? How's the intonation on it? Any serious dents?

I think that part of your problem is that not too many people are willing to take a chance on that 3 upright + 1 below valve combination. Ergonomically, those horns do take some getting used to. Personally, I'm looking to get away from that kind of valve setup, but $3000 is a fair price for any good CC.
